#136f1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#136f1c is composed of 7.5% red, 43.5%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.8%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 125.9 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 25.5%. #136f1c color hex could be obtained by blending #26de38 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#136f1c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b03 is the darkest color, while #f9f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#136f1c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#404240 is the less saturated color, while #047e10 is the most saturated one.
